Seekh Kebab

Seekh Kebab is a popular Pakistani dish consisting of spiced minced meat molded onto skewers and grilled. It is known for its rich aroma and smoky flavor, often enjoyed as street food or at festive gatherings, symbolizing the vibrant meat-centric culinary traditions of Pakistan.

Ingredients

  • minced lamb or beef
    500 grams
  • onion
    1 medium, finely chopped
  • garlic paste
    1 tablespoon
  • ginger paste
    1 tablespoon
  • green chili
    2, finely chopped
  • fresh coriander leaves
    a handful, chopped
  • garam masala
    1 teaspoon
  • red chili powder
    1 teaspoon
  • salt
    to taste
  • oil or ghee
    2 tablespoons

Originating from the Mughal era's rich meat preparations, Seekh Kebabs were refined in the Indian subcontinent, particularly in what is now Pakistan, blending Persian and local cooking techniques.
